Senate still uphill for Democrats

March 24, 2006 10:05 AM

Sabato's Crystal Ball still sees Senate as rolling boulder uphill for Democratic majority. But, as more seats open, things become more unpredictable. Democrats need to win 6 seats in the Senate to take control. Gerrymandering is less important for Senate races however, and that is good news for some challengers especially if the anti-incumbents show up at the polls in unpredicted large numbers.
